One of the primary examples that were able to catapult Merkle to achieve the AWS Data and Analytics Competency so quickly was our work at Ulysse Nardin.  Ulysse Nardin is a Swiss luxury watchmaking company founded in 1846 in Le Locle, Switzerland. The company became known in the nautical world for manufacturing highly accurate marine chronometers and complicated timepieces used by over fifty of the world's navies from the end of the 19th century till 1950.

Merkle took upon the challenge of containerizing the main technical components of Magento to build a fully cloud native CMS for the first time.  With short timelines and a constant need for increased innovation, Merkle was able to deliver a modern and complete Ecommerce content management system (CMS) platform on AWS.
